Distance From Windsor Airport to Willow Run Airport (YQG - YIP Distance)
The flight distance from Windsor Airport (YQG) to Willow Run Airport (YIP) is 30 miles. This is equivalent to 48 kilometers or 26 nautical miles. The distance shown below is the straight line distance (may be called as flying or air distance) or direct flight distance between airports.
48 kilometers is the distance from Windsor Airport, Canada to Willow Run Airport, United States.
